She is pretty.
Hi.
Sorry about this question but is this correct to say she is pretty? "es bonita"? Or would it be "Ella es bonita"? I'm not sure whether the subject pronoun is needed or not. Thanks all. |

Either way is OK. In Spanish the use of the pronoun is not as important as it is in English because in Spanish the pronoun is innate in the verb tense if that makes sense. If you use the pronoun too much in Spanish you will sound very gringo.
Es muy bonita may refer to the girl or the chair she's sitting on. If you need to be specific, use the pronoun.
